Pay me less, but don't call me back to work! The return to office vs WFH struggle

An online survey showed that 65% of workers questioned were willing to take a pay cut in order to maintain the current status of work from home (WFH). 

The survey which was commissioned by an insurance firm Breeze as per Bloomberg found that 65% of American workers who said their jobs could be done entirely remotely were willing to take a pay cut of 5% to stay at home and work. 

Nearly half of the respondents also said they were willing to reduce paid time off given by the company to be able to work from home as it increases productivity.
